Aurora church to open fall season of community 'Wednesday Night Gatherings' Sept. 6
After a summer hiatus, Wesley United Methodist Church in Aurora will resume Wednesday Night Gatherings Sept. 6.
Featuring a hamburger cookout and games, the event will be held from 6 to 8 p.m. outdoors on the church's north lawn at 14 N. May St. in Aurora. The public is invited.
Gatherings are held on first and third Wednesdays during the school year. Bonus Gatherings are held on fifth Wednesdays.
Gatherings coordinator Michelle Curiel, the church's children and family director, said attendees are invited to bring a dish to pass. Games will include bean bag toss, sidewalk chalk and hoola hoops.
In case of inclement weather, the gathering will be held in the Gathering Place room.
Wesley holds Sunday worship online at 9:30 a.m. and at 10:30 a.m. in the church sanctuary.
